Fencing

Sports Wrap

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

The Harvard men's fencing team ran its record to 4-0 last night by notching a 32-16 victory MIT and a 14-13 squeaker over Rutgers in a tri-meet at MIT.

Senior Captain Stephen Kaufer led the Crimson in the epee division, notching six victories without a defeat. In the foil division, Jeft Levy went 5-1 on the night.

The Harvard women's fencing team, meanwhile, dropped a 9-7 decision to the Engineers at MIT.
